Signs Your Driveway Requires Attention
A first indicators which your driveway might need professional attention are the appearance of cracks. Minor hairline cracks can quickly evolve into larger fissures if not taken care of promptly. Such cracks can allow water to seep into the asphalt, resulting in further deterioration. Should you notice multiple cracks or if they are deepening, it is a clear sign your driveway requires immediate evaluation and possibly a reseal.
Another sign to look out for includes the presence of potholes. These depressions can arise due to weather fluctuations, heavy traffic, or underlying base issues. If potholes start to appear, it is essential to repair them quickly as they can cause more significant damage and safety hazards. Repairing potholes not only enhances the appearance of your driveway but also prevents further degradation and extends the lifespan of the asphalt.
In conclusion, discoloration and surface wear can indicate that your driveway is in need of maintenance. A driveway that looks faded or shows signs of aging may benefit from sealcoating, which can help protect against UV rays and moisture damage. Should you observe any significant fading, it’s a good idea to consult a professional to assess whether your driveway needs resealing or if more extensive repairs are on the horizon.
Asphalt Care and Repair Methods
Consistent upkeep is key to prolonging the duration of asphalt surfaces. One of the most efficient methods is seal coating, which not only improves the appearance of the surface but also protects it from ultraviolet radiation, moisture, and chemicals. It is advised to apply sealcoating to commercial parking areas once every 2-3 years, depending on usage and local conditions. Signs that your driveway needs a skilled recoating include noticeable fading, minor cracks, or a uneven surface finish.
When it comes to repairs, understanding the distinction between patch repair and full overlay is crucial. Patching is typically used for minor areas of damage, such as holes or fissures, where just the affected part is removed and patched. On the other hand, a full overlay involves resurfacing the entire surface, which can be advantageous for areas showing extensive wear or deterioration. It is essential to evaluate the state of the surface prior to choosing on the suitable restoration method.
Proper water management is critical for maintaining the structural soundness of asphalt surfaces. Water pooling or poor drainage systems can result in foundation issues and major damage as time goes on. Implementing effective drainage solutions, such as drainage channels and proper grading, can assist reduce these issues. For high-traffic zones, it is crucial to monitor how excessive vehicle loads affect the asphalt's integrity, and consider employing methods to avoid rutting and other forms of damage.

Choosing the Right Paving Options
Choosing the best paving solution for your premises necessitates careful consideration of different factors, including traffic levels, climate, and maintenance demands. For both home and commercial spaces, bitumen and concrete are the most common selections. Asphalt Road Projects paving is often preferred for its smooth surface and faster installation time, making it ideal for projects that need a fast turnaround. On the other hand, cement offers greater durability and longevity, particularly in areas with intense traffic or extreme weather conditions.
Asphalt is a adaptable and cost-effective solution, especially for spacious parking lots and driveways. Its flexibility allows it to handle variations in temperature and significant loads. However, it is crucial to maintain the bitumen surface through regular sealcoating and timely fixes. Addressing problems like breaks and potholes promptly can enhance the lifespan of the surface and maintain its aesthetic appeal. In contrast, cement may need less frequent maintenance but is considerably higher in cost at the start and can be susceptible to breaking if not installed accurately.
Ultimately, the selection between bitumen and cement should match with the particular requirements of your site. Take into account factors such as the amount of use, risk of damage, and local weather patterns.
